In Exchange For Smiles
by Jimmy D. Freeman
A smile sent from me to you,
To say I hope you don't feel blue,
I sit here thinking for a while,
About your company while I smile,
Life moves fast and love is fleeting,
But know there will be another meeting,
Between you and love's true grace,
So keep a warm smile on that face,
If you don't you'll sport a frown,
Which will surely bring others down,
So think of me smiling in front of you,
And hopefully soon you'll not feel blue.
